Latest Patents
One of his latest inventions is the Compact Autonomous Coverage Robot. This autonomous coverage robot features a chassis with forward and rearward portions, along with a drive system integrated into the chassis. The forward portion of the chassis is designed in a substantially rectangular shape. The robot is equipped with a cleaning assembly mounted on the forward portion, and a bin is positioned adjacent to the cleaning assembly to collect debris that is agitated during the cleaning process. A bin cover is pivotally attached to the lower portion of the chassis, allowing it to rotate between a closed position, which secures the bin, and an open position, which provides access to the bin opening. Additionally, the robot includes a body attached to the chassis and a handle located on the upper portion of the body. A bin cover release mechanism is conveniently actuatable from near the handle.
